Overview

Becoming an electrician in Greenville, OH, typically begins with an apprenticeship, combining hands-on experience with classroom learning, allowing individuals to earn while they learn. Apprenticeships in the area last about four to five years, requiring extensive training under licensed professionals. According to the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, there are approximately 338 electricians in Greenville, with wages averaging around $600.50 per week for entry-level positions. The average annual overtime for electricians in Greenville is approximately $4,800. Trade schools, local unions, and platforms like Gild help aspiring electricians find apprenticeship opportunities, leading to a career with strong earning potential—often exceeding $75,000 annually for experienced professionals.
